Why Live in Sinking Spring

Sinking Spring, located about 5 miles west of Reading, PA, is a small suburban borough with a population of 3,000 and an agricultural and industrial heritage. The town spans 1.5 square miles and features a mix of housing, from historic brick or stone exteriors to newer homes in subdivisions like Brookfield Manor. Penn Avenue is the main thoroughfare, lined with businesses, shops and fast-food restaurants. Residents enjoy a variety of things to do, including parks, trails and minor league sports, all within a 10-minute drive. The nearby city of Reading offers more restaurants, theaters, bars and the historic FirstEnergy Stadium, home to the Fighting Phils minor league baseball team. West Reading features The Barley Mow, a popular brewery with a backyard beer garden and an extensive craft brew menu. Students in Sinking Spring attend schools in the Wilson School District, which is highly rated for its performance in standardized testing, student progress and college readiness. The Yocum Institute for Arts Education provides classes and programs in visual arts, dance, yoga, theater and music, along with a preschool and kindergarten program and summer camps for children.
